Women's Footy
womensbanner.jpg

The first ever women's footy match in the UK was organised by Aussie Rules UK and was held in London on 21 April 2007 as part of the ANZAC Sports Challenge.

Great fun was had by all and Aussie Rules was most definitely the winner!

Women's footy returns on 26 April 2008, again as part of the ANZAC Sports Challenge.
